Stability analysis on segment k207+690~830 slope of Huangling-Yan’an highway

  • Based on the analysis of the characteristics of segment K207+690~830 slope of Huangling-Yan'an highway,the stability of the slope,affected by rainfall infiltration,is contrastively studied by means of surplus thrust force method,limit equilibrium theory and strength reduction FEM.Considering the characteristics of the slope,a comprehensive treatment plan combining gravity retaining wall and draining surface-water is advanced.The analysis and assessment of the slope stability after treatment show that the safety factor of the slope is greatly increased.Compared with the conventional analytical method of slope stability,the safety factor of slope obtained through strength reduction FEM is reasonable,and bears definite physical significance.The paper concludes that the superiority of strength reduction FEM in the analysis of slope stability and reinforcement effect is obvious,which deserves practice and generalization.
